Major flood stage. Widespread and extensive flooding along the Belle Fourche River with inundation of structures and roads possible.
Moderate flood stage. The Belle Fourche River will begin to spread out in a few locations around Belle Fourche. Water may approach a few of the ball fields at the Roundup Sports Complex. Water may begin to overflow the lower banks near the Redwater River confluence.
Minor flood stage. Lower portions of the River Walk may be covered with water from the Belle Fourche River.
Low lying areas along the Belle Fourche River may flood.
Impact statements from the National Weather Service, describing what typically happens at each water level.

The NWS-defined flood stage for Belle Fourche River at Belle Fourche is 2994 feet. Action stage begins at 2992 feet. Moderate flooding starts at 2996 feet, and major flooding at 2998 feet.
